
The Origins of Jamaica Frenzy
The origins of Jamaica Frenzy can be traced to Lil Ray’s ClubHouse Jamboree. For over 20 years, The Clubhouse Jamboree holds court as one of the longest running, free, outdoor, House Music events in New York City. and it takes place every year, on the second Sunday in September, since 1994, when it first started at the Prospect Park Bandshell.
The event is hosted and financed every year by liL Ray, with the help of his wife, his family, and many friends who volunteer their time and energy, along with some of the biggest name DJs including DJ Spinna, Karizma, Quentin Harris and artist in the world of House Music, who come from other states and countries. The community event has grown from a gathering of friends and like minded individuals who came together for the last outdoor House music party of the season, into now, a behemoth of an event, and for many, this is now a “must attend” event, with people coming from all over the world. The ClubHouse Jamboree is now one of the largest HOUSE MUSIC event in Prospect Park.
